The Journey of David Hoffmeister: From Teacher to Authority
David Hoffmeister’s journey began with a profound personal awakening that led him to study A Course in Miracles (ACIM), a spiritual text centered on the principles of love and forgiveness. Over the years, he has dedicated his life to teaching these principles, emphasizing their application in everyday situations. His role as a teacher has evolved into that of an authority figure in the realm of spirituality and mental health, guiding countless individuals toward healing and understanding through his lectures, workshops, and published materials.

Who is David Hoffmeister?
David Hoffmeister is a spiritual teacher and author known for his work with A Course in Miracles. His teachings focus on healing through forgiveness, love, and the recognition of our shared consciousness.
What are the core teachings of David Hoffmeister?
Hoffmeister’s core teachings center around non-duality, forgiveness, and the idea of a unified mind. He encourages individuals to transcend ego-based illusions to experience true peace and connection.
